As the title says I'm part way through a temporary contract as a Postie with driving, but another DO nearby is advertising for a permanent post? Obviously the security would be much better than what I have now. Can I apply?
If so what's the best way, should I call in the other DO and see if the DOM will support it? I'm guessing my current DOM won't as his office put time in training me up? Also if I don't get the other job is it likely to effect my chances of being kept on at the end of my current temp contract?

You need to be in RM 6 months before you can officially transfer.
Is the other role more hours? If not you may as well stay where you are, it's rare RM don't renew temp contracts and you'll be made permanent eventually.
If it is more hours apply online and HR might pick up on it and initiate a transfer regardless.

I'd apply on-line and if you get it there's basically nothing anyone can do about it!
If you pop into the Office for a chat they'll only tell you to apply online, but it can't do any harm.
